The Stylus Showdown: 2024 vs. 2025

First, let’s rewind. The 2024 Moto G Stylus 5G was the comeback kid of the series, ditching its plasticky past for a vegan leather back that felt like a hug for your palms. Add a brighter display and a performance bump, and it was basically the Cinderella story of mid-range phones. But the 2025 model? Oh, it’s flexing. That OLED display isn’t just sharper—it’s a full-on *vibe*, with colors so rich they’ll make your Instagram feed weep. And the stylus? Motorola’s calling it “enhanced,” which, in corporate speak, means *”We finally noticed people actually use this thing.”* Pressure sensitivity upgrades? Check. Smoother strokes for your doodles and notes? Double-check.
But here’s the kicker: that $400 tag. For context, the 2024 model was practically a steal at $250. So, is the 2025 version just a fancy repackaging of last year’s hits, or did Motorola actually earn that markup? Let’s dissect the evidence.

Display & Stylus: Glow-Up or Gloat?

The 2025 model’s OLED screen isn’t just an upgrade—it’s a mic drop. Deeper blacks, truer colors, and outdoor visibility that doesn’t require squinting like you’re deciphering a ransom note. For artists, note-takers, or anyone who’s ever cursed a laggy stylus, this is a game-changer. But here’s the catch: if you’re just using the stylus to poke at your grocery list, the 2024 model’s display is *fine*. More than fine, actually—it’s still a solid 1080p LCD that won’t leave you feeling cheated.
And that “enhanced” stylus? Sure, it’s snappier, but let’s not pretend the 2024 version was a potato. Unless you’re sketching the next *Mona Lisa* or taking notes like a courtroom stenographer, the improvements might feel… *subtle*.

Performance & Battery Life: Speed vs. Stamina

The 2025 model’s chipset is faster—no surprises there. Apps launch quicker, multitasking is smoother, and your TikTok-scrolling thumb gets a well-deserved break. But here’s the plot twist: the 2024 model *still* wins the battery life marathon. That extra oomph in the 2025 version comes at a cost, and it’s not just dollars—it’s screen-on time. If you’re the type who forgets their charger exists until the 5% panic sets in, the 2024’s endurance might be the real MVP.

The Verdict: Upgrade or Hold Your Ground?

Here’s the cold, hard truth: the 2025 Moto G Stylus 5G is *better*. But is it *$150 better*? That depends on your wallet and your whims.
Worth the splurge if: You live by your stylus (artist, note-taking fiend), crave that OLED eye candy, or just *need* the snappiest performance.
Stick with 2024 if: Battery life is your holy grail, you’re a casual stylus dabbler, or the phrase *”But it was on sale!”* gives you a serotonin rush.
